Are you a motivated, “hands-on” Designer/Art Director interested in an opportunity to work on a range of creative projects for one of the world’s premiere entertainment brands? WWE is considering experienced and creative Designer/Art Director candidates to develop highly visible creative solutions impacting an enormous global audience. The right candidate’s design work will help define the look of the WWE brand across a wide range of creative projects including logo design and branding, key art, and off-air promotional campaigns; live event promotional materials, consumer products, and much more. The candidate must enjoy working in a fast-paced, fun environment, be conceptual, and have the ability to take projects to completion. Your portfolio needs to demonstrate cutting-edge work that stands out from the clutter, fresh thinking, and a creative approach to problem solving, and you must be extremely advanced in Photoshop and an expert in Illustrator.
Key Responsibilities:
• Work with Creative Directors, Copywriters, and other Art Directors to develop consumer products and packaging, marketing materials, and all other types of creative projects company-wide, from concept to completion
• Execute key deliverables such as photographic composition, typographic layout, logo development, and vector illustration
• Create design, and multi-task to answer an aggressively scheduled assigned project list while toggling through immediate group initiatives
• Interact with Project Management as well as the Creative Services Studio Group and collaborate on project trafficking and production ensuring on-time, proper finished product results
• Keep current with WWE Network and television programming, characters, storylines, and products
Qualifications:
• 5+ years of hands-on design and art direction experience
• Sports and entertainment brand experience a plus
• Expert in Photoshop, Illustrator, and InDesign
• Proactive, detail-oriented, and professional
• Able to work on multiple projects simultaneously with tight deadlines
• Able to think, react, and execute effectively in a fast-paced environment
• Able to listen to initial direction and revise and execute against internal critiques
• Collaborative with a solutions-oriented attitude and willingness to pitch in as needed
• Interested in social and cultural trends and fashions
• Bachelor degree/BFA or equivalent experience preferred
